  • DataExport problem-ODBC Layer Error: [21S01]-ORA-00947

    Hi,
    I have one planning application from which I want to transfer data to Oracle DB in the table "t". I have 11 dimension in the planning application, so I have created 12 columns in the table "t"(11 for dimension-members and 1 col for value) with the following script---
    create table t (
    a varchar2(100),
    b varchar2(100),
    c varchar2(100),
         d varchar2(100),
         e varchar2(100),
    f varchar2(100),
         g varchar2(100),
         h varchar2(100),
    i varchar2(100),
    j varchar2(100),
         k varchar2(100),
         l number)
    I have created a wire protocol dsn. But when I execute the following calcscript ---
    fix (jan,budget,fy08)
    DATAEXPORT "DSN" "xz" "t" "tstschma" "password" ;
    ENDFIX
    then it is showing error below---
    [Mon Jul 13 00:04:10 2009]Local/essdb/Plan1/admin/Info(1021000)
    Connection With SQL Database Server is Established
    [Mon Jul 13 00:04:10 2009]Local/essdb/Plan1/admin/Info(1012695)
    DataExport can not do batch insert to relational table. The ODBC driver and/or RDBMS doesn't support batch insert. Using record by record SQL export
    [Mon Jul 13 00:04:10 2009]Local/essdb/Plan1/admin/Info(1021013)
    ODBC Layer Error: [21S01] ==> [[DataDirect][ODBC Oracle Wire Protocol driver][Oracle]ORA-00947: not enough values]
    [Mon Jul 13 00:04:10 2009]Local/essdb/Plan1/admin/Info(1021014)
    ODBC Layer Error: Native Error code [947]
    [Mon Jul 13 00:04:10 2009]Local/essdb/Plan1/admin/Error(1012085)
    Unable to export data to SQL table [t]. Check the Essbase server log and the system console to determine the cause of the problem.
    [Mon Jul 13 00:04:10 2009]Local/essdb/Plan1/admin/Info(1021002)
    SQL Connection is Freed
    [Mon Jul 13 00:04:10 2009]Local/essdb/Plan1/admin/Warning(1080014)
    Transaction [ 0x920001( 0x4a5a097a.0x7918 ) ] aborted due to status [1012085].
    [Mon Jul 13 00:04:10 2009]Local/essdb/Plan1/admin/Info(1012579)
    Total Calc Elapsed Time for [datexprt.csc] : [0.062] seconds
    [Mon Jul 13 00:04:10 2009]Local/essdb/Plan1/admin/Info(1013274)
    Calculation executed
    Please guide me if I am doing anything wrong...
    Thanks & Regards.

    Hi,
    It all depends on you dense dimension being used in your export, it will use a column for each member.
    For example if the dense dimension on the export was period and you were doing a level 0 export (level0 members of time are Jan:Dec)
    Then there would need to be a column for each dimension and 12 columns for each of the periods (Jan:Dec)
    The best way to work it out is to export to a file first in column format and you will see how the table needs to look.
    The columns have to exactly match the data being exported.

  • Informix ODBC driver error while creating a view in Designer

    I nedd to ceate a view in a universe (Business Objects XI R2) that is connected to an Informix database. I use the 3.34 ODBC Informix driver.
    When I write the select statement (select column from table) and check the syntax I have the following error:
    "Exception: DBD, [Informix][Informix ODBC Driver][Informix]A syntax error has occurred.State: 42000"
    Is there anybody who has solved this problem??
    Thanks in advance to anyone who can give me hints on how to solve problem.
    Fabrizio

    Hi Fabrizio,
    The error state 42000 indicates that there is a syntax error or access violation. If you are using an Informix native client connection then add the following parameter <Parameter Name>"Force SQLExecute">Always</Parameter> in the informix.sbo file. Restart Designer and then try to create a derived table with a simple select statement.
    If you are using an ODBC connection, then add the above mentioned parameter in the Generic section of odbc.sbo file.
